Position Title: Crossing Guard - Part-Time Reports to: Crossing Guard Coordinator

Dept/CC: Police Department Hourly Rate: $18.00

Position Purpose

As a city crossing guard, you have the opportunity to safely escort pedestrians and remind motorists of local traffic laws and regulations. You can develop important professional competencies, such as communication, listening, attentiveness and problem- solving skills, that are valuable in many scenarios. Whether you are assisting in creating traffic patterns, utilizing tools to guide vehicles and pedestrians, working with authorities to track errant drivers or learning about local traffic laws and signs, there is unprecedented room for growth.

If you are someone who appreciates helping others and understands the importance of being detail oriented, this job could be just what you are looking for.

Essential Functions
  • Direct pedestrians across streets after assessing traffic flow to identify breaks to allow for visibility and safe crossing.
  • Guide motorists through traffic patterns designed to keep pedestrians safe and inform drivers of detours if required.
  • Understand the traffic laws, signs and speed limits posted within a designated jurisdiction to effectively guide vehicles and people.
  • Communicate crossing rules and regulations to students and ensure their understanding for optimal safety.
  • Collaborate with officials to develop traffic patterns that are conducive to safety, efficiency and convenience.
  • Maintain a crossing area that is free of hazards, and employ the appropriate tools and equipment, including lights, flags and hand signals.
  • Identify drivers who are speeding or driving carelessly and notify authorities by documenting their license plate number.
  • Vigilantly watch for impending dangers to develop effective solutions before an accident occurs.
  • Report the unsafe behavior of students to school officials to reduce the risk of someone getting hurt while crossing or waiting to cross a street.
Qualifications
  • High school diploma or equivalent
  • Social perceptiveness and strong eyesight.
  • Keen understanding of local traffic laws and regulations.
  • Ability to stand for long periods of time.
  • Scheduled hours up to 10 hours per week.
  • Schedule is dependent upon when school is in session.
